Not known Facts About legal advice
The UK supplies a number of routes for firms to consider. Our immigration authorities can tutorial you thru what's greatest for you and your enterprise.Dependant upon your reason for planning to arrive at the united kingdom, the visa that you will need to apply for will likely be different. Our experts will be able toes If you're suitable for the m